Icebreaker Toolkit: Simple Openers That Actually Work
Feeling unsure what to say is normal. Start with low-pressure lines that invite a short answer and give you room to follow up.
- Profile-based hook: Notice one specific detail in their profile and ask about it. Example: “I saw you’re into weekend hiking—what trail surprised you most?”
- Curiosity + choice: Offer two fun options so they can pick. Example: “Coffee or matcha for a straight‑to‑the-point morning pick-me-up?”
- Micro-observation: Point out something small and genuine instead of a grand compliment. Example: “Nice photo with the golden retriever—what’s their name?”
- Light callback: If they mention a hobby, reference it in a playful way later. Example: “You mentioned pottery—ever make something that surprised you?”
- Safe, open question: Ask for a preference that reveals taste without being invasive. Example: “Beach vacation or city weekend—which would you pick and why?”
- Short, playful challenge: Use a friendly dare that invites a one-line reply. Example: “Two truths and a lie—go!”
How to avoid common pitfalls:
- Don’t lead with generic praise. Replace “You’re beautiful” with a specific observation tied to their profile.
- Avoid heavy or overly personal questions right away. Skip topics like past relationships or finances on the first message.
- Don’t copy-paste one-liners. Tweak each opener to include something unique from their profile so it feels personal.
- Keep it short. One-to-three sentences is enough to start a chat without pressure.
Quick templates to adapt:
- “I noticed you [detail from profile]. What’s the best thing about that?”
- “I’m torn between [option A] and [option B]. Which would you pick?”
- “That photo at [place or activity] looks great—what’s the story behind it?”
Use these patterns to create conversation starters that feel natural, low-pressure, and easy to reply to. Small, specific prompts lead to longer, more genuine chats—one message at a time.
